# CVE-2025-13824

## Summary

- **CVE ID:** CVE-2025-13824
- **Severity:** HIGH
- **CVSS Score:** 8.7 (C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:N/VC:N/VI:N/VA:H/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N)
- **CWE:** CWE-763
- **Published:** Dec 15, 2025
- **Last Modified:** Mar 13, 2026

## Description

A security issue exists due to improper handling of malformed CIP packets during fuzzing. The controller enters a hard fault with solid red Fault LED and becomes unresponsive. Upon power cycle, the controller will enter recoverable fault where the MS LED and Fault LED become flashing red and reports fault code 0xF019. To recover, clear the fault.

## Affected Products

- Rockwell Automation — Micro820®, Micro850®,  Micro870® (V23.011  and below)
- Rockwell Automation — Micro820®, Micro850®,  Micro870® (V12.013 and lower)
- Rockwell Automation — Micro820®, Micro850®,  Micro870® (V14.011 and lower)
